I am a long time Dellorto guy but being new to the Type 3 set up, I am looking for advice. I am building a 1776 for my Square and will be running DRLA's. I have the manifolds but not the air cleaner base plates or the linkage set up. What I need is some photos of linkage set ups as well as short velocity stacks. Do you run the short air correction jets ? Photos would be great as I an a visual type guy.

I have the correct linkage kits for type 3 using IDF's / DRLA's you can run a 1¾" air cleaner with a 1" stack inside, but the air cleaners are stamped steel, the cast air cleaner / linkage style ones are junk, they hit the body badly with the engine installed,
